I personally own one vv see spec's below. I play UT2k4, and UT99 on it, but those are the only games that can play without turning everything off. Both at 40+fps. Using XP, and the latest drivers. I tried playing fear combat...but i got horrible frames, and that was for 800x600 res. Bottem line is, unless you're only playing games older than 2k4, or you want to get better battery life, find a laptop with integrated card. Or, do what i did, and play all of my games on my desktop, and use my laptop for its mobility, and just one or two games when i need some killin on the go
